Grip Size

What is the size of a tennis racquet grip?

What size should a racquet grip be?

How to choose the appropriate grip size?

The size of a tennis racquet grip refers to the circumference or distance around the handle, including the stock grip that comes installed with your racquet, which ranges from 4 inches to 4 3/4 inches.

Within that range, there are seven available grip sizes, which start at 4 inches or a size zero and increase by 1/8 inch for each size up to 4 3/4 inches for a size six.

Depending on which country you live in, you may find the sizing of the racquet grip expressed differently, so a chart is provided below.

SizeInchesMillimeters
04102
14 1/8105
24 1/4108
34 3/8111
44 1/2114
54 5/8118
64 3/4121

You’ll often find the size of a tennis racquet listed on the butt cap of the tennis racquet, which you can find at the very bottom of the handle. If you don’t see it there, check for it around the throat of the racquet frame.

Why Does Grip Size Matter?

Beyond providing you with comfort when playing tennis, the appropriate grip size can help prevent injury.

A grip that’s too small may tend to twist or rotate within your hand when striking the ball, which can lead to painful blisters and unnecessary strain on your arm as you overcompensate by holding the grip too firm. Over time, this can contribute to injuries such as tennis elbow. A grip that is too small can also have an increased tendency to slip from a player’s hand.

On the other hand, a grip that’s too large can be challenging to hold, and as a result, put unnecessary stress on your hand, wrist, and arm.

Furthermore, a large grip can be challenging to manage when you need to change grips quickly or when you’re looking to snap your wrist when serving or hitting an overhead because it restricts movement.

The key is to find a grip size that feels comfortable, prevents undue stress on your body, and allows for proper range of motion.

Selecting The Appropriate Grip Size

There are two common methods used to help identify the ideal grip size for a player. It’s typically recommended using both to help get the best fit.

Measure Your Hand

First, if you have one handy, grab a ruler or measuring tape. Next, take a look at your dominant hand, and you’ll notice you have a bunch of lines and creases running through your palm.

You’ll see two larger lines in the middle of your palm, one on top and one on the bottom, running horizontally from one side to side.

Grab your ruler or measuring tape and line it up vertically with your ring finger so that the bottom of the ruler lines up with the top horizontal line in your palm and measure to the top of your ring finger.

You should find that the measurement falls somewhere between 4 inches and 4 3/4 inches.

This method works great if you’re ordering online, and you don’t have access to test out multiple grip sizes in person. If you do order online and you’re between sizes, then go with the smaller size as it’s much easier to increase the size of a grip than decrease it.

Test Grips in Person

Another method you can use to find the right grip size is to try out multiple sizes in person and reference the gap between your fingers and your palm when holding the racquet.

First, grab a racquet handle with your dominant and note the size of the grip. With your other hand, place your index finger within the gap between your fingers and your palm. You’re looking for a grip where that space is roughly equal to your index finger’s width.

Once you find the grip size that matches up, try one size above and below to compare and see what feels best. The racquet should feel comfortable yet secure.

Many players will fall between sizes. As mentioned before, if that’s you, go for the smaller size because it’s easier to increase your grip’s size than it is to decrease it.

For example, the addition of an inexpensive overgrip will increase the size of your grip by 1/16 of an inch or a half size. Similarly, you can have a local racquet technician add a heat shrink sleeve to the grip to increase the size by 1/8 of an inch for a full-size increase.

However, apart from swapping out the base grip that came with the racquet or removing it altogether, it is difficult and, in some cases, not possible to drop the size of a grip.

Tennis Racquet Grip Sizes for Kids

For kids, there are typically fewer grip size options than adults. Most will usually fall at 4 inches or less – it depends on the manufacturer.

However, instead of finding the right grip size, parents will want to focus on the length of the racquet, which generally corresponds with the height of your child. The following chart outlines those sizes.

Inches:

AgeHeightRacquet
4 or younger40 in or less19 in
4-5 years40-44 in21 in
6-8 years45-49 in23 in
9-10 years50-55 in25 in
10 or older55+ in26 in

Centimeters:

AgeHeightRacquet
4 or younger102 cm or less48.3 cm
4-5 years102-113 cm53.3 cm
6-8 years114-126 cm58.4 cm
9-10 years127-140 cm63.5 cm
10 or older140+ cm66.0 cm

If you get the right length tennis racquet for your child that they can comfortably handle, the grip size should work itself out.

However, even if the grip is a little bit large, don’t be overly concerned. First off, your child will grow into it quickly, and second, most young kids won’t be playing aggressively or long enough with that grip size for it to have any real negative impact on their hand, wrist, or arm.

Demoing Grip Sizes for the Perfect Fit

Although the reviewed methods are helpful for point players toward their ideal grip size, there’s no substitute for testing out different grip sizes while playing.

For that reason, it’s highly recommended for players to get their hands on a few different tennis racquets with varying grip sizes before making a decision and buying a tennis racquet.

In a perfect world, once you’ve settled on a specific model tennis racquet, you’d try the same racquet with multiple size grips. If your local tennis shop only has one grip size available for demo, then there are a few online retailers offering demo programs worth checking out.

Of course, hitting with a few different types of racquets with varying grip sizes is better than nothing if that’s all you have at your disposal.

Although finding the right grip size takes a bit of trial and error, it pays to get something that feels comfortable and doesn’t hold you back. Luckily, once you’ve found the right grip size as an adult, you’ll know for all future racquet purchases – so you only need to go through the process once.

As a parent, you don’t need to worry too much about grip sizes for your kids until they transition to full-size 27-inch tennis racquets where there is a greater variety of grip sizes. You’ll also likely need to remeasure for the appropriate grip size as they grow.
